The Virtual Medical Staff: A Comprehensive Guide
The rise of telemedicine and remote patient care has spurred a significant shift in how healthcare organizations operate. Many clinics and hospitals are now adopting a virtual medical staff, this strategy offering substantial benefits. This guide examines the key aspects of building and managing a successful virtual team, covering everything from personnel selection to platforms integration.
- Defining Roles: Physicians , nurses, medical assistants, and administrative staff can all play vital functions remotely.
- Technology Stack: Secure communication channels, electronic health records (EHRs), and video conferencing are necessary components.
- Legal and Compliance: Understanding HIPAA regulations and state licensing laws is vital .
- Training and Onboarding: Specialized training is necessary to ensure proficiency in virtual workflows.
